Aadhar Housing Finance Ltd (AADHARHFC) — Working Capital to Net Assets Ratio
Aadhar Housing Finance Ltd (AADHARHFC) has a Working Capital to Net Assets ratio of 347.3% as of September 2025. Working capital of Rs239.47 Billion (current assets of Rs240.85 Billion minus current liabilities of Rs1.39 Billion) is measured against net assets of Rs68.94 Billion. A higher ratio indicates strong short-term liquidity financed by the equity base. Annual Working Capital to Net Assets for Aadhar Housing Finance Ltd (2021–2025)
The table below presents the year-by-year Working Capital to Net Assets ratio for Aadhar Housing Finance Ltd from 2021 to 2025, covering 5 annual filings. Each row shows current assets, current liabilities, working capital, net assets, the ratio, and the change in percentage points compared to the prior year. | Year | WC/NA Ratio | Working Capital (INR) | Net Assets | Current Assets | Current Liabilities | Change (pp) |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2025 | 40.8% | Rs26.01 Billion | Rs63.72 Billion | Rs51.89 Billion | Rs25.88 Billion | ▲ +6.8 pp |
| 2024 | 34.0% | Rs15.12 Billion | Rs44.50 Billion | Rs40.35 Billion | Rs25.23 Billion | ▲ +17.4 pp |
| 2023 | 16.6% | Rs6.15 Billion | Rs36.98 Billion | Rs36.37 Billion | Rs30.22 Billion | ▼ -28.2 pp |
| 2022 | 44.8% | Rs14.10 Billion | Rs31.47 Billion | Rs33.73 Billion | Rs19.62 Billion | ▼ -17.4 pp |
| 2021 | 62.2% | Rs16.74 Billion | Rs26.93 Billion | Rs44.21 Billion | Rs27.47 Billion | — |
